Abstract

Writing manuscripts is an integral part of the research journey. Despite the availability of various guidelines to inform study reporting and manuscript preparation requirements by peer-reviewed medical journals, developing manuscripts that effectively communicate study findings or new knowledge requires a range of communication skills that evolve with successes and failures.
